Historically, lumber used for building in fact matched the small dimensions. For instance, a 2 x 4-inch stud was exactly that size. However, by the 1960s, this size had reduced to a completed measurement of 1-1/2 x 3-1/2 inches. What products utilized in the 1940s to 1960s are currently understood to be hazardous? Poisonous lead paint and asbestos are known hazardous products made use of during that time.
Concrete, specifically strengthened concrete, is a relatively brand-new, however reliable material in the building market. The enhancement of rebar inside the blend of concrete before it solidifies makes it more powerful and longer-lasting. It's a low-cost choice that attracts attention for building structures, structures, wall more info surfaces, and entire houses. Nonetheless, provided the ratio of weight to tensile stamina, concrete typically needs to be reinforced to prevent it from fracturing.
